> > > On Fri, Jul 17, 2020 at 08:04:18PM +0530, Akhil P Oommen wrote:
> > > > On targets where GMU is available, GMU takes over the ownership of GX GDSC
> > > > during its initialization. So, move the refcount-get on GX PD before we
> > > > initialize the GMU. This ensures that nobody can collapse the GX GDSC
> > > > once GMU owns the GX GDSC. This patch fixes some GMU OOB errors seen
> > > > during GPU wake up during a system resume.

> > > The Signed-off-by needs to be at the end but I think Rob can do that for you.
> >
> > It does?  I've always been told that this is supposed to be roughly a
> > log of what happens.  In that sense you added your SoB before the
> > review/test happened so it should come before.  I know some
> > maintainers seem to do things differently but that seems to be the
> > most common.  In that sense, I think the order that Akhil has is
> > correct.  ...but, obviously, it's up to the maintainer.  ;-)
>
> yeah, I chronological order was my understanding too.. but presumably
> the Reported-by happened before the Signed-of-by (which is how I
> reordered things when applying the patch)
